MY STORY

Since 2019, I’ve been traveling the world while working remotely. What I do isn’t extraordinary: I teach online—just by chatting with people.

When I left Hong Kong in 2019 with my savings, I had no idea how I’d make it work.

A year later, I was broke.

But I didn’t want to go back. I loved this lifestyle and was determined to keep it.

The challenge?

I didn’t have a teaching diploma, and I wasn't confident in the languages I was fluent in.

Then one day, I discovered I could earn money by helping people practice the languages they're learning. No teaching certificate required—just conversation, guidance, and enthusiasm.

That discovery changed everything.

And the best part? I can share this story not only in English, but also in the other languages I’m fluent in—so I can connect with even more people around the world.
